International Airlines Group (IAG) has confirmed that it has signed a non-disclosure agreement (NDA) with American Airlines as it is interested in taking a stake in the restructured carrier, which could also merge with US Airways Group.
"We have signed a non-disclosure agreement with American," an IAG spokeswoman told Reuters. "We are interested in looking at taking a possible stake in a restructured American if they welcome it and if it will bring benefit to our shareholders."
